Regulatory Framework for Online Gambling in India
The regulatory framework for online gambling in India is complex and evolving. The country’s gambling laws are primarily governed by the Public Gaming Act of 1867, which prohibits gambling in most forms. However, there are some exceptions, and the landscape is changing with the rise of online gambling.
Current Legal Framework
The Public Gaming Act of 1867 prohibits gambling in most forms, with some exceptions. For example, lotteries are allowed, but only with a license from the state government. The Act also allows for the operation of casinos, but only in specific locations, such as Goa and Sikkim.
The Information Technology Act of 2000 and the Information Technology (Intermediaries Guidelines) Rules, 2011, also play a crucial role in regulating online gambling in India. These laws require intermediaries, such as online gambling platforms, to comply with certain guidelines and regulations.
